Friday Fanfare
The grand edifice emerges as a shining
testament of the coast's glamorous side. Once on the property, visitors
are surrounded by a dazzling water fountain, dreamy gardens, and
beautiful blooms. The striking stucco complex towers overhead, adorned
with dark glass.
Venture to your guestroom before exploring all the shops Beau Rivage
offers. Standard rooms boast enchanting Gulf or garden views. The
spacious accommodations come complete with vibrant artwork, custom
furnishings, and white marble bathrooms. Even on a gray winter's day,
the water views inspire romance.
Grab lunch at Café Jardin in the lobby atrium. The zesty Quesadilla
Wrap ($8.75) satisfies those who crave a little more spice.
Later, browse the 13 shops on the hotel's promenade. When only diamonds
will do, stop by The Jewelry Box. For pottery and artwork by Mississippi
artists, such as Gail Pittman, shop at Beau Rivage Emporium. Four lines
of colorful everyday plates, which Gail designed specifically for the
resort, stay in demand (10-inch plates are $44).
Dinner? You'll feel as if you're part of one big family at La Cucina
Italiana restaurant. This upscale establishment flaunts an open kitchen,
so diners can watch their feast being made. Don't miss the creamy
tiramisu for dessert. Afterward, drop by the Coast Brewing Company for a
sample of Mississippi's first and oldest microbrew. It also offers live
music and dancing nightly.
